A 13-strong Somerfield Te Kura Wairepo squad had a successful outing at the South West Zones Cross Country at Halswell Quarry on Tuesday.

The team of Hazel Rutherford, Penny Ingram, Mia Croft, Freddie Panckhurst, Jesse Laurie, Jordan White, Stanley Staunton (Year 5), Anna Evans, Isla Williams, Lucy Sewell, Guy Moore, Pedro Machado Wada, Taila Iino-Curd (Year 6) joined 13 other schools in warm conditions – but slippery underfoot – at the Quarry this week.

Eight of our runners qualified for the Central Zones and will return to Halswell Quarry on June 22 including Hazel and Guy who were second in the girl's Year 5 and boy's Year 6 race respectively, while Anna and Mia both finished third in their age groups – Ka mau te wehi!

A big thank you to our parent helpers who provided transport and were our cheer squad around the course.
